AI Technical Summary

Technical Problem

Existing grain storage cleaning equipment is insufficient to thoroughly clean dust and pests from the gaps in walkways, and it also poses risks of being time-consuming, labor-intensive, and contaminating food safety.

Method used

A grain storage pest collector was designed, which uses a double-layer filter and a detachable power supply component. It quickly removes dust and pests through a suction and filtration mechanism. The filter is made of non-woven fabric that is easy to remove, and the power supply component is externally detachable for easy battery replacement.

Benefits of technology

It enables rapid and thorough cleaning of dust and pests from the gaps in the grain storage walkways, reducing maintenance costs, improving cleaning efficiency and operational comfort, and ensuring food security.

Claims

1. A grain storage pest collector, comprising a collection bucket, characterized in that: It also includes a suction pipe mounted on the collection bucket and a fan installed inside the collection bucket. The fan operates to cause the suction pipe to suck up pests. A collection component is provided at the connection between the suction pipe and the collection bucket to collect the pests sucked up by the suction pipe. The collection component is detachably connected to the collection bucket for easy cleaning of the pests. The collection bucket is also provided with a power supply component electrically connected to the fan. The power supply component is detachably connected to the collection bucket. The collection bucket has an opening at the top and a lid is provided at the opening. The collection component is located inside the collection bucket at a position corresponding to the opening. The collection component includes a first filter and a second filter. The first filter is a cylindrical shape with one end open, matching the inner diameter of the opening. The second filter is a cylindrical shape with one end open, matching the inner diameter of the first filter. The second filter is fitted inside the first filter to perform double filtration. When the airflow generated by the fan passes through the collection component, the pests remain in the first filter or the second filter.

2. The grain bin pest collector of claim 1, wherein: The suction tube is located on the bucket lid.

3. The grain bin pest trap of claim 2, wherein: The bucket lid has a locking hole in the middle, into which the end of the suction tube is locked. The periphery of the bucket lid protrudes upward to form a flange. The upper end of the collection bucket is provided with a buckle, and the flange is provided with the buckle to be fastened to the collection bucket. There are several buckles, which are evenly spaced on the outer periphery of the bucket lid.

4. The grain bin pest trap of claim 1, wherein: The outer wall of the first filter screen is provided with a first limiting ring. The outer diameter of the first limiting ring is larger than the inner diameter of the bucket opening. When the first filter screen is inserted into the collection bucket, the first limiting ring limits the first filter screen to the bucket opening. The outer wall of the second filter screen is provided with a second limiting ring. The outer diameter of the second limiting ring is larger than the inner diameter of the first filter screen. When the second filter screen is inserted into the first filter screen, the second limiting ring ensures that the second filter screen always remains coaxial and in close contact with the first filter screen.

5. The grain bin pest trap of claim 1, wherein: A filter element is also provided between the fan and the collection assembly, and the filter element is used to filter out tiny impurities in the airflow.

6. The grain bin pest trap of claim 1, wherein: The power supply assembly is detachably mounted on the outside of the collection bucket via a connecting assembly. The connecting assembly includes a clamp surrounding the outer periphery of the collection bucket and a fixing hook mounted on the clamp. The fixing hook is used to fix the power supply assembly.

7. The grain bin pest trap of claim 6, wherein: The outer periphery of the collection bucket is radially recessed to form an annular groove. The clamp matches the annular groove so as to be locked in the annular groove. The fixing hook is installed on the side of the clamp that protrudes from the annular groove and extends out of the annular groove.

8. The grain bin pest trap of claim 6, wherein: The power supply component is installed inside the battery pack, and a hanging ring is provided on one side of the battery pack. When the hanging ring can be hung on the fixing hook or removed, the power supply component can be connected to or separated from the collection bucket.
